The article is listed in “Landmarks in Canadian Aviation”. The article features two black-and-white pictures. The first picture on the top left is Royden Foley himself, working for the Wright Brothers, circa 1916, in N.Y., U.S.A. With Royden in the cockpit of the Plane. The article below the picture is a biography of Royden Foley's aviation career. The second black-and-white photo on the right shows four gentlemen in front of a G-CAAB Plane. From left to right are H.S. McClelland, Unknown, H.N Hyslop, H.D Barley
